Capacity Gaps in Rural Wyoming

In Wyoming, particularly within its 23 frontier counties, small artisans often struggle to reach wider markets due to the vast geographical distances and limited infrastructure. These counties have an average population density of just six people per square mile, leading to significant barriers for local artisans trying to establish their businesses. The majority of these artisans lack access to adequate marketing resources and digital platforms that would enable them to connect with customers beyond the state’s borders. Overcoming these capacity gaps is critical for fostering economic resilience in Wyoming's rural communities, where traditional industries are struggling to maintain employment levels.

Infrastructure and Workforce Constraints

The lack of robust infrastructure and a skilled workforce further compounds these challenges. Many rural areas lack access to high-speed internet, which limits the effectiveness of online sales strategies for local artisans. Additionally, a high percentage of the populace in these areas are employed in agriculture and extraction industries, leaving little room for diversification into creative sectors. Equal access to technological tools and skills training is essential for empowering these small business owners. This grant funding is particularly focused on bridging the gap in digital literacy and resource availability, equipping local artisans with the means to thrive in a competitive landscape.

Readiness Requirements for Grant Application

To be eligible for this funding, applicants must demonstrate a clear understanding of how their projects will address these capacity gaps. Successful applicants will need to articulate their plans for establishing e-commerce platforms and conducting digital marketing campaigns specifically catered to the artisan community in Wyoming. This might include partnering with local tech experts or organizations that specialize in online retail strategies. Furthermore, applicants should present a readiness to engage in direct training opportunities to develop skills that are immediately applicable to their businesses.

Expected Outcomes of the Grant for Wyoming Communities

The primary goal of this funding is to enhance market access for Wyoming artisans, aiming for measurable outcomes such as increased sales and engagement with consumers outside the state. Programs funded will focus on providing foundational knowledge in e-commerce and digital marketing, allowing artisans to actively participate in a broader market. Expected increases in revenue can have ripple effects, providing local jobs and stimulating the overall economic environment in these sparsely populated regions.
